Countertop manufacturers use particleboard in a variety of sizes, but generally ¾” thick panels in 30″ widths in 8’, 10’ and 12’ lengths are most suitable for countertop cores. There are several types of laminate sheets available for countertops, and each has advantages of its own. Here’s a quick rundown of the best laminate countertops. Particleboard has been the standard for laminate substrate for a long, long time.
